A chief magistrates’ court in Abeokuta on Friday sentenced a 35-year-old man, Kabiru Lawal, to three months’ imprisonment for stealing goats and ram.

Mr Lawal, who resides in the Olomore area of Abeokuta, pleaded guilty to stealing and conversion on two counts.

The magistrate, V.B. William, convicted Mr Lawal following his guilty plea to the charges preferred against him.

Ms William sentenced him to three months each for the first and second counts, saying that the sentences must run concurrently.

She, however, gave him the option of restituting the goat and ram amounts to the complainant.

Earlier, the prosecutor, Insp Lawrence Olu-Balogun, told the court that Mr Lawal committed the offences sometime in June 2023 at No. 47, Kuforiji Olubi Drive, Abeokuta.

Mr Olu-Balogun said the defendant fraudulently obtained eight goats and one ram valued at N300,000, property of one Ibrahim Akanbi, under the pretence of helping the complainant sell the goats and ram.

“The complainant gave the defendant eight goats and a ram to help him sell them, but the defendant sold all of them and converted the money to his personal use.

“After committing the crime, he ran out of Ogun state without remitting the money to the complainant but was later caught,” he said.

The prosecutor said the offences contravened section 419(b) and 390(3) of the Criminal Code Laws of Ogun, 2006.
